Guildhall Street Apartment, Bury St Edmunds
Located in an excellent central spot in the Medieval part of Bury, this smart first floor apartment forms part of a small, newly converted building surrounded by a vast array of superb restaurants, bars, shops and local attractions – ideal for a city break or a base from which to work in the town.

SPACE
The door from Guildhall Street (operated by a buzzer for security) opens into a courtyard where you’ll find the key safe before mounting the metal staircase to the apartment door exclusively. The door opens into the hall with access to the bedroom, bathroom and living room.
LIVING/KITCHEN/DINING ROOM
This light and airy room has kitchen units against one wall housing a Bosch oven with ceramic hob, a washer/dryer, an under counter fridge, a free standing microwave, kettle and toaster. The sitting area has a comfy sofa positioned for watching the wall mounted TV and there's a table with a couple of chairs which can be used for dining or as a work station.
BEDROOM
A king size bed takes pride of place in this stylish carpeted bedroom, between bedside units with a chest of drawers and hanging rail so you can unpack fully and settle in.
SHOWER ROOM
This hotel quality shower room has a double shower cubicle with rain shower and hand held, a WC, wash basin, ample space for toiletries and a heated towel rail with tow
towels provided for you.
OUTSIDE
The apartment is conveniently close to the heart of town with all the historic buildings, restaurants, shops and attractions on the doorstop. The pretty Guildhall, dating back to 1279, is in the oldest continuously-used civic building in Britain and is open to the public for a range of fascinating exhibitions throughout the year, so do check dates on the website before booking. It proudly boasts a World War Two Royal Observer Corps Control Centre which is well worth a visit, and has some concerts.
